Placement | Medical Microbiology |
Year | F2 |
Region | West |
Hospital(s) | The Queen Elizabeth University Hospital Glasgow |
Main Duties of Placement | To help deliver a clinical diagnostic service to the clinical teams and GP practices served by the Department. This will involve an initial 6-week familiarisation placement in the laboratory learning bench techniques followed by clinical liaison, specialist ward rounds and MDT meetings for the remainder of the placement. |
Typical Work Pattern | 9am-5pm Monday-Friday. No on-call. |

Teaching | Weekly one-to-one Consultant/Registrar teaching on relevant infection topics. Monthly pan-Glasgow Consultant teaching of trainees. |
Unique Selling Points | This represents an opportunity to become integrated within a Microbiology department giving advice on patient management with close daily contact with Consultants giving support and supervision.
